There are two vertical angles in a figure with measures m∠1=(2x−16)° and m∠2=98° . What equation will solve for x ?(2 points)

Since vertical angles are congruent, we have:

m∠1 = m∠2

(2x-16)° = 98°

Now we can solve for x by isolating the variable:

2x - 16 = 98

Add 16 to both sides:

2x = 114

Divide both sides by 2:

x = 57

Therefore, the equation that will solve for x is 2x - 16 = 98.
